Abstract
A spectroscopic method to measure directional spectral emissivity for homog eneous and heterogeneous semi-transparent materials, giving access to a lar ge spectral 10-12 000 cm(-1) range and to temperatures lying between 600 an d 3000 K is reported. Sample heating is supplied by a carbon dioxide laser and the blackbody flux reference is obtained with a lanthanum chromite furn ace. Experimental results obtained with this setup on several dielectric ox ides such as silica, alumina, and magnesia are in good agreement with the r esults obtained by an indirect method based on the Kirchhoff's laws. A brie f overview of the setup abilities and a detailed discussion of the emissivi ty spectra are also proposed. (C) 1999 American Institute of Physics. [S003 4-6748(99)01810-9].
